After 13 years, used-car trading platform Dashioucha finally lists on Nasdaq

Dianshoucha, the Chinese used-car trading platform, has listed on Nasdaq after 13 years in business. The company positions itself as an AI infrastructure layer for China’s used-car industry and says it helps dealers digitize workflows and reduce transaction friction. It plans to use most of the proceeds to strengthen its digital solutions and expand dealer transaction services, while also investing in AI capabilities. The filing highlights strong market penetration, including embedded workflows across a large share of China’s used-car dealers and inventory management at scale.
